But what exactly are NFTs, and why are they being hailed as manna from heaven for the creative community?

At its core, an NFT is a type of digital asset that represents real-world objects like art, music, in-game items, and videos. They are bought and sold online, frequently with cryptocurrency, and they are generally encoded with the same underlying software as many cryptos. However, unlike cryptocurrencies such as Bitcoin or Ethereum, which are fungible, meaning they can be exchanged one for another, NFTs are unique. The “non-fungible” part of their name means they cannot be exchanged on a like-for-like basis, which makes them akin to owning an original painting in the digital world.

Why NFTs are Revolutionary for Artists and Creators

  1. Ownership and Authenticity: For the first time in the digital realm, artists can claim ownership over their creations in an indisputable way. Through blockchain technology, each NFT can be traced back to its original creator, ensuring the authenticity of the work and preventing unauthorised reproductions. This is particularly ground-breaking in a world where digital art has been notoriously easy to copy and distribute without permission.
  2. New Revenue Streams: NFTs have opened up new avenues for artists and creators to monetise their work. Unlike traditional art sales, artists can continue earning a percentage of sales whenever their NFT changes hands after the initial sale. This means that if their work increases in value over time, they benefit financially, creating a more sustainable income model.
  3. Global Market Access: The digital nature of NFTs means that artists can reach a global audience without the need for galleries or intermediaries. This democratises the art world, allowing emerging artists to gain visibility and sell their work to an international community of collectors and enthusiasts.
  4. Innovative Art Forms: NFTs aren’t just transforming the market for digital art; they’re inspiring the creation of new forms of art. From interactive pieces to digital experiences that evolve, artists are leveraging NFT technology to push the boundaries of what art can be, engaging with their audiences in innovative ways.

Challenges and Considerations

While NFTs offer a host of benefits, they also come with certain challenges. The environmental impact of the blockchain technology underlying NFTs has been a point of contention, given the significant energy consumption associated with cryptocurrency transactions. Furthermore, the NFT market can be volatile, with the value of digital assets fluctuating wildly. Artists and creators venturing into this space must navigate these complexities while also protecting their intellectual property rights.
